  • Patent number: 4963683
    Abstract: A process for synthesizing polyoxa tetracyclics which involves the ozonolysis of a single-ring-structure vinyl silane with resulting direct formation of the desired multiple ring matrial. The polyoxa tetracyclic compounds have the formula ##STR1## The vinyl silanes have the structure ##STR2## The vinyl silanes are new chemical compounds as are corresponding primary ozonide and dioxetane intermediates. In a preferred embodiment, this invention provides a total synthesis of the antimalarial artemisinin.

  • Patent number: 4474806
    Abstract: Sulfonyl or carbonyl derivatives of inositols are found to be effective phospholipase C inhibitors and thereby potent anti-inflammatory and analgesic agents. These inositol derivatives are prepared by condensation of a protected inositol with a substituted sulfonic or carboxylic acid derivative followed by removal of protecting groups.
